Cardiorespiratory exercise training in children.

S P Sady.   

Abstract

Definitive statements concerning the cardiorespiratory effects of exercise training in children cannot be made. Few carefully controlled and well-defined exercise training studies including important cardiorespiratory variables have been conducted. Generally, it appears that the response to training in pubescent and postpubescent children is not different from what is observed in adults.
